CELEBRATE PROSPERITY AND DONBURI DELIGHTS AT KAZUMA

January 24, 2025 by StrawberrY Gal

 Start the year with a feast of prosperity and indulge in the comforting flavours of Japanese donburi at Kazuma Japanese Restaurant. This January, we are offering two exceptional dining experiences that blend tradition, innovation, and the finest Japanese ingredients. Whether you are celebrating Chinese New Year or simply craving a delicious bowl of donburi, we have something special for you.

Prosperity Japanese Yee Sang (6 January – 12 February 2025)

Celebrate Chinese New Year with a unique blend of tradition and Japanese flair. Toss to success, health, and happiness with our Prosperity Japanese Yee Sang, a festive dish that combines the vibrant flavours of yee sang with a touch of Japanese elegance. We offer two kinds of yee sang, serving for 3 – 4 persons:

• Plain Yee Sang: RM88.00 nett ; Fresh Salmon Yee Sang: RM108.00 nett

Prosperity Feast 7-Course (29 & 30 January 2025)

Savour the tastes of luxury with our Prosperity Feast, a 7-Course Set Menu for RM225.00 nett per set, designed to elevate your Chinese New Year celebration. Featuring the finest Japanese ingredients, each dish symbolizes prosperity and good fortune.

• Zensai: Kaki Namasu & Nori Chip (Persimmon Salad & Crispy Seaweed Chip)

• Mushimono: Hotate Chawanmushi (Japanese Steamed Egg with Scallop)

• Sashimi: An assortment of three sashimi varieties – salmon, hamachi and ohtoro 

• Shirumono: Edamame Soup (Green Soybean Soup with Shrimp)

• Yakimono: Gindara Saikyo No Ebi Imo (Grilled Miso-Marinated Cod Fish with Shrimp & Sweet Potato)

• Shokuji: Hiyashi Somen (Japanese Chilled Somen Noodles)

• Dessert: Matcha Ice Cream & Abekawa Mochi

For those who crave comfort and flavour, explore our Donburi Delights this January – a range of mouthwatering rice bowls filled with the perfect balance of textures and tastes. Each donburi is expertly crafted with premium ingredients to create a satisfying and harmonious meal.

• Engawa Chirashi Sushi Don (Flounder Fin Sashimi Don) – RM108.00 nett 

• Gyuniku Don (Tenderloin Beef & Egg Don) – RM75.00 nett

• Wakatori Misoyaki Don (Grilled Miso Glazed Chicken Don) – RM30.00 nett

• Saba Steak Don (Grilled Saba Fish Don) – RM30.00 nett
